Я хочу создать дайджест сообщения Sha1, и он должен использовать мой закрытый ключ в качестве ввода наряду с простым текстом.
Все, что я нашел, либо не использует закрытый ключ, либо просто принимает много сертификатов в качестве ввода.
Я использую DCPCrypt для своих криптографических нужд. http://www.cityinthesky.co.uk/opensource/dcpcrypt
Он с открытым исходным кодом и действительно хорошо работает. После установки пакета используйте TDCP_sha1 и поместите его в форму.Затем посмотрите, как использовать компонент в файлах справки в каталоге DOC в zip-файле.
DOC
Посмотрите на TurboPower LockBox